Wiaan Mulder breaks the silence to the strange statement after the reaction for Brian Lara

At a time when he shocked the fans and praised the world, South Africa’s captain, Wiaan Mulder, made headlines not only for his extraordinary shake, but also because of his deep respect for one of the greats of the game, Brian Lara, on Monday, July 7.

On the 2nd of the second race against Zimbabwe at the Queens Sports Club de Bulawayo, Wiaan Mulder did very few, as he left the opportunity to create history to save the world record of Brian Lara in the traditional format of the game Monday.

Wiaan Mulder reveals why he refused to make history in Bulawayo

With 367 unbeaten 367, only 33 runs the world record of Lara 400* in the test cricket, Mulder stunned everyone in declaring the South African entrances in 626 for five to lunch on day 2.The standing captain has taken this call not for the strategy, but out of respect.

Speaking of the impatient decision, Mulder admitted that he could have broken the record of all -time testing of the West Indies, but considered his record deserved to be “exactly as it should.” This appointment has won millions of hearts worldwide.

In a video shared by Fancode in X, Wiann Mulder told The Proteas Great Shaun Pollack: “First, I thought we would have enough, and we have to do bowl. And secondly, Brian Lara is a legend, we are going to be real. He had 400 against England and for someone of this stature to keep this record is quite special.”

Brian Lara iconic 400 deserves to be “exactly as it should be”: Wia Mulder

Mulder revealed that the main southbound coach -Shukri Conrad, encouraged the idea of ​​leaving these milestones in legends. The young man, 27, emphasized that, if he has the opportunity again, he would probably make the same call, as he feels that someone in Lara’s stature maintains the right record.

Continued. “If I have the opportunity again, I would probably do the same. I was talking to our coach, Shukri Conrad, and said:” Listen, let legends keep the great scores. “

Zimbabwe struggles in Bulawayo after Wiaan Mulder saved Brian Lara’s legacy

Wiaan Mulder’s statement not only made him a hero, but also set up a new South Record -African for the highest individual tests. Its 367* is now the fifth tallest in the history of the test cricket.

But the biggest conversation was that Lara 400’s legendary did not mark that he scored against England in Antigua in 2004, remained intact because Mulder chose not.

Zimbabwe team later launched by 170 and was forced to follow. By blows, it was 51 for one in the second post in the second race against South -Africa in Bulawayo.

Well, Zimbabwe is currently showing the fight, and its current score is 143/3, and ended with 313 runs against the side of Proteas in the second in Bulawayo.
